Cadw's description
Location
Prominently sited within the linear group of historic buildings leading to St. James's Square on the east side of Monmouth and about 300m east of the town centre.
History
Early/midC18, and then re-windowed in c1800, there are some changes to the rear elevation.
Exterior
Red brick with floor bands, Welsh slate roof. Double depth plan with central entry. Three storeys, five windows set almost flush with the wall, 6 over 6 pane sashes under segmental arches, 3 over 6 on the upper floor. Central 6-panel door with transom light and hood supported on brackets. Plain roof with narrow stacks on both gables.
Rear elevation has ranges of sashes as above, but much of it is obscured by a large Nissen type extension.
Interior
Interior not seen, but the building has been converted into club premises on the ground floor and flats above.
Reason for designation
Included for its special architectural interest as an C18 house of definite character near Monmouth town centre.
